Engineering & Construction Machinery PartsChina Uchida Rexroth Ap2d12, Ap2d21, Ap2d25, Ap2d36 Hydraulic Piston Pump Oil Pump, Find details about China Water Pump, High Pressure Pump from Uchida Rexroth Ap2d12, Ap2d21, Ap2d25, Ap2d36 Hydraulic Piston Pump Oil Pump